Supply Chain Daily Planning and Production Manager is responsible for leading a team to lead and execute the plan for day to day operations of the DC production and financials (no transportation). Develop labor strategy and budget strategy. Leads cross functionally to ensure that all inputs are considered organized and planned to meet both short term and long term goals. Responsible for any reporting for these areas by reviewing its accuracy relevance and takeaways so that any areas of opportunities can be recommended. Develops strategies in the areas based on the reporting so recommendation for improvement can be shared cross functionally. This role is involved with current and future strategic plans to help achieve JD/Finish Lines strategic goals. This individual will effectively exhibit JD Finish Lines core values of Customer People Winning Community and Financial Responsibility in everything they do by performing the following key duties:
Manages the team that is responsible for retail waves production and flow of work for the DC. Partners with cross functional groups to make sure plans are being met to achieve set goals.
Oversees operational labor planning. Partners with the Supply Chain operations leadership to understand processes and how the work mix allocations and schedule affects supply chain capacity. This includes being involved in weekly meetings with the group to review various topics (ie financials results opportunities in the business).
Responsible for developing plans for throughput goals on a daily weekly monthly and annual basis and drive the necessary actions to achieve these goals in the most efficient cost effective and productive manner.
Oversees team that analyzes production and hiring needs throughout the year. This leads to recommendations and strategic conversations on how to improve .
Works with the Merchandising leadership team and DC Operation leadership team to prioritize inbound containers for ontime delivery while balancing DC flow.
Manages team that analyzes and reviews PO information to determine where there could be challenges based on open orders inbound availability and staffing plans.
Oversees and creates analyzes and provides actionable insights and presentations to various groups within the Finish Line organization for strategic planning of supply chain initiatives.
Helps create and maintain all reporting that is utilized by the DC operations that pertains to production cost performance (CPU) and labor management.
Responsible for the teams that execute the supply chain budget except transportation. Works with a variety of internal supply chain groups to help achieve given timelines and financial goals. This includes meeting the needs of all parties by creating reporting and functional models to achieve those requests. Making necessary adjustments based on results along with all IPs that may be requested.
Works with the vendor relations manager and across vendors to help build a lasting partnership that is beneficial for all parties involved.
Utilizes advanced Excel BI and Access skillset to help improve areas of the business.
Responsible for direct report oversight team members including interviewing hiring training; planning assigning and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and performance managing employees; addressing inquiries and resolving problems; ensuring all direct reports are continuously developing and are set up for career growth.

Required Education and/or Experience
Bachelors degree (B.A. from a fouryear college or university and at least 23 years in leadership experience and 23 years analyst function preferably with supply chain familiarity or equivalent combination of education and experience.
Required Computer and/or Technical Skills
Should have advanced knowledge and abilities with Microsoft Office Access Excel or Google Suite equivalents. Ability to learn and apply Finish Line DC Warehouse management system warehouse control system labor management software and payroll software applications.
